### Test Plan — Image Cache Leak (Fernbyte Viewer)

Support has reported growing memory usage in the Fernbyte Viewer after long browsing sessions. The suspected cause is the thumbnail cache retaining decoded bitmaps past eviction. This plan covers a 2-hour soak test cycling 5,000 images while sampling heap every minute. Reproduction requires the diagnostics endpoint on the Marlowe staging host, which is authenticated. When filing results, include heap snapshots. Use the staging credential below for all diagnostics calls.

session JWT of yawep-yawep = eyJhbGciOiJIUzI1NiIsInR5cCI6IkpXVCJ9.eyJzdWIiOiI3pWF3_In0.aXYsHiog

# ReportForge env — sorting stability notes for release
# As of build 4.2, the grid engine in ReportForge switched to a stable
# merge sort so rows with equal keys keep their source order. This fixes
# the intermittent diff noise in nightly exports that Marit flagged.
# Do not re-enable QUICKSORT_FALLBACK; it reintroduces unstable ordering
# on ties and will break the regression snapshots kept by the Delvane
# team. Legacy ordering is gone for good in this release train.
# The signing credential for export manifests goes on the next line.

env line for fafof-fahag: LEDGER_TOKEN5=f8790

It maintains no local queue state; all pending jobs live in the Corvette job store, so instances may be replaced at any time without draining. Always deploy the spooler before upgrading the driver bridge, as the bridge negotiates its protocol version against whatever spooler it finds. Health probes should pass within thirty seconds of startup. Before promoting a build, verify that the environment supplies the configuration values shown below.

deployment values, tagug-tagaf:
[zorix]
team = druix
access_code = ac_42e3e2
host = zorix.qirvancorp.test
port = 6379
owner = beldor.gordor
peer = kelath.zemvarcorp.test